 Euphoria Station
 The Reverie Suite
 Review by Gary Hill
This new album is the second from this artist. The group started as a duo, performing acoustic music. That sort of stripped back, grounded element remains at the core of the music here. The closest comparison to be made would be folk prog, but this works into other territory, too. The vocals are of the female variety, provided by Saskia Binder. This music gets into some intriguing journeys and wanders down some cool alleyways. Yet it remains tied to accessible hooks and earthy elements, too. It makes for an intriguing and effective set.
